Alevtina Ibragimova defeated Clara Burel 3-6, 7-6, 6-4 in the quarterfinals of the Palermo tournament on clay. Ibragimova converted 67% of her break points, while Burel converted 44%. Ibragimova secured 6 service breaks, one fewer than Burel's 7.
